在当今的信息化时代,网络安全已成为一个不容忽视的话题。其中,脚本注入攻击是网络安全中常见的一种攻击手段。今天,我们就来聊聊如何学会魔道脚本注入,即使是小白也能轻松上手。本文将为您提供一份实操指南全解析,让您深入了解脚本注入的原理、方法和技巧。
一、脚本注入概述
1.1 什么是脚本注入?
脚本注入,顾名思义,就是攻击者在网页中注入恶意脚本代码,以达到窃取用户信息、篡改网页内容等目的。常见的脚本注入类型有:SQL注入、XSS跨站脚本攻击、CSRF跨站请求伪造等。
1.2 脚本注入的危害
脚本注入攻击不仅会损害网站和用户的利益,还会对整个网络环境造成严重威胁。以下是脚本注入的一些危害:
- 窃取用户隐私信息,如用户名、密码、信用卡号等;
- 篡改网页内容,误导用户;
- 植入恶意软件,如木马、病毒等;
- 控制服务器,进行大规模攻击。
二、魔道脚本注入原理
2.1 魔道脚本注入简介
魔道脚本注入是一种基于JavaScript的攻击方式,攻击者通过构造特定的JavaScript代码,利用网页漏洞实现对用户信息的窃取和篡改。
2.2 魔道脚本注入原理
魔道脚本注入主要利用以下原理:
- 利用网页漏洞,如未对用户输入进行过滤的表单提交、未对URL参数进行转义的URL重定向等;
- 构造恶意JavaScript代码,通过注入点将代码注入到网页中;
- 利用浏览器解析和执行JavaScript代码,实现对用户信息的窃取和篡改。
三、实操指南
3.1 准备工作
- 安装开发工具:如Chrome浏览器、Firebug插件等;
- 学习JavaScript基础:了解JavaScript语法、DOM操作、事件处理等;
- 学习网页漏洞知识:了解常见网页漏洞类型及其成因。
3.2 漏洞寻找
- 检查网页源代码,寻找可能的漏洞点;
- 使用工具,如Burp Suite、OWASP ZAP等,对网页进行安全测试。
3.3 构造恶意脚本
- 根据漏洞类型,构造相应的恶意JavaScript代码;
- 使用编码工具,如JavaScript Encoder等,对恶意脚本进行编码,避免被网站过滤。
3.4 注入恶意脚本
- 通过漏洞点,将恶意脚本注入到网页中;
- 观察网页效果,确认恶意脚本是否成功执行。
3.5 信息窃取与篡改
- 根据恶意脚本的实现,实现对用户信息的窃取和篡改;
- 分析窃取到的信息,评估风险。
四、总结
学会魔道脚本注入,可以帮助我们了解网络安全的重要性,提高网络安全意识。然而,在学习和使用脚本注入技术时,我们必须遵守法律法规,不得利用所学知识进行非法攻击。本文旨在为广大小白提供一个实操指南,希望对您有所帮助。
最后,提醒大家在学习和实践过程中,务必注意以下几点:
- 遵守法律法规,不得利用所学知识进行非法攻击;
- 保护个人信息,不随意泄露;
- 关注网络安全动态,提高自身安全意识。
